In May 2012 i4c and Aura signed a collaboration together where i4c was named non executive assessor of Aura Fundació. The main objective is that Aura will double their activities in a term of 5 years. In 2014, 169 people were attended in Aura, of which 145 are in the work placement programme, 27 new contracts have been achieved, and 112 people have a remunerated job thanks to the Supported Employment Methodology.
